By: Denny Horner | 2010-03-28 | Real Estate The real estate market is just starting to put itself together in today's harsh economy. In Washington DC real estate, there are more available for sale homes in a neighbourhood than there are stable family-owned homes. What makes it hard for realtors is that when they try to show these homes, some of the yards are strewn with garbage and the houses are in a mess inside. If the nicer homes cannot be sold either in the same neighbourhoods, then no one is a winner. If you can overlook the cosmetic problems, you can easily grab up a property for much less than previously offered.
